How to cancel your home insurance
You can cancel your home insurance policy whenever you’d like. Here’s how.

Contrary to popular belief, there is no rule stating that you have to see out your home insurance policy for the full year. In fact, you can cancel at any time. There may be a small cancellation fee but it probably won't be big enough to deter you.
It's pretty straightforward. Follow these steps below.
You: Hi, I'm calling to cancel my home insurance policy please. Can you let me know what I need to do to organise this?
Them: I'm sorry to hear that you're cancelling. Do you mind telling why you'd like to cancel your policy?
At this point, you can either tell them why you're leaving but if you want to avoid further discussion, you can use our prepared response.
You: It's just not a priority for my budget at the moment.
At this point, they will likely offer you a cheaper premium. If you still don't want the insurance, just thank them for the offer and state that you'd still like to cancel.
Them: No problem, we can process this on our end and arrange for the refund of your unused premium.
You: Thank you.

If you're within your cooling off period, then no. If you're outside of your cancellation period then there may be a small fee. We've outlined all the cancellation fees we know of from popular providers. If your provider isn't listed below, refer to your product disclosure statement (PDS) as it'll be written in there.

There is no situation where you can’t cancel your policy. As long as you let your insurer know you want to cancel and you pay the relevant fees, you should have no problem cancelling.
If you cancel within your cooling-off period and you have made a claim, you can still cancel but you won’t receive any refund for the period you were insured.
